First Amendment loving, free speech supporting patriots turned out en masse in small town Manchester, Tenn. Tuesday night to protest the upcoming DOJ stance that Muslim bashing on social media may lead to federal civil rights charges.
Conservative activist Pamela Geller was among the 600-800 protesters who filled the conference room, according to Bill Hobbs who live tweeted from the event.
The American Muslim Advisory Council of Tennessee sponsored the event, called “Public Disclosure in a Diverse Society,” which featured the top two U.S. Department of Justice officials in the state, the U.S. Attorney for the Eastern District of Tennessee, Bill Killian, and the special agent in charge of the state’s FBI office, Kenneth Moore.
The DOJ officials discussed the fact that not all American Muslims are terrorists and those who trash Muslims on social media may be violating civil rights. You can read more here from BizPac Review’s, “DOJ warns Muslim bashing on social media may be federal offense.”
